Common Issues and Errors Related to 342.MSVCR110.dll
DLL files, fundamental to our systems, can sometimes lead to unexpected errors. Here, we provide an overview of the most frequently encountered DLL-related errors.
- Cannot register 342.MSVCR110.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
- 342.MSVCR110.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.
- This application failed to start because 342.MSVCR110.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
- 342.MSVCR110.dll Access Violation: The error signifies that an operation attempted to access a protected portion of memory associated with the 342.MSVCR110.dll. This could happen due to improper coding, software incompatibilities, or memory-related issues.
- The file 342.MSVCR110.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.

Perform a System Restore to Fix Dll Errors
In this guide, we provide steps to perform a System Restore.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
System Restore
in the search bar and press Enter. -
Click on Create a restore point.
-
In the System Properties window, under the System Protection tab, click on System Restore....
-
Click Next in the System Restore window.
-
Choose a restore point from the list. Ideally, select a point when you know the system was working well.
